Binaural Integrated Active Noise Control and Noise Reduction in Hearing Aids

Abstract: Abstract-This paper presents a binaural approach to integrated active noise control and noise reduction in hearing aids and aims at demonstrating that a binaural setup indeed provides significant advantages in terms of the number of noise sources that can be compensated for and in terms of the causality margins.

“…While this pattern of benefit is already relevant for current technology (e.g., Patel et al, 2020 ; Serizel et al, 2010 , 2013 ), it will become increasingly important as more powerful algorithms such as artificial intelligence speech enhancement ( Fedorov et al, 2020 ; Healy et al, 2013 ; Wang, 2017 ) become included in more hearing devices. Such algorithms can generate unprecedented improvements to SNR, but those improvements will not be realized at the ear when a standard hearing aid is used because the noise floor will be limited by the direct path.…”
